Methylcellulose is a common ingredient used in the food, pharmaceutical, and cosmetic industries for various functions such as thickening, emulsifying, and stabilizing. It is a non-toxic, water-soluble polymer that is derived from cellulose. Some synonyms for methylcellulose include cellulose methyl ether, hypromellose, and hydroxypropyl methylcellulose. These synonyms refer to similar compounds that have different properties and uses in various industries. While they may be interchangeably used in some cases, it is important to understand their unique characteristics and applications to ensure proper utilization and avoid any undesirable effects.
